About Geneva
Geneva is a quirky tabby-tortie with a silly streak and a fondness for playful antics. She loves attention and will reward you with sweet finger kisses, but gets a little jumpy if you move too quickly. Snuggling isn’t her first choice—Geneva would rather chase toys or race after a laser pointer, and she'll happily entertain you with her lively hunter instincts. Still, if you win her trust and call her over, she’ll melt for a good booty rub. Geneva is patient with other cats, though she appreciates a slow introduction. She gets along well with calm dogs and children who are gentle and ready to play.
